Gireum Tteokbokki is quite the opposite of Gungmul Tteokbokki, by having minimal broth/soup. It literally means oil tteokbokki in Korean. For this dish, rice cakes are stir-fried with chili oil, minced garlic, etc. It tastes like Rice Cake Skewers (tteok kkochi). Gireum tteokbokki is a specialty of Tongin Market next to Sajik Park in Jongno-gu.

Gireum tteokbokki (or gireum ddukbokki) translates to "oil rice cakes" in Korean. Unlike the saucy tteokbokki simmered with gochujang, this version is a dry saute of rice cakes tossed in a soy.

For Gireum Tteokbokki, instead, the rice cakes are actually stir-fried in chili oil, just like its name implies. The history of this yummy streetfood being sold at Tongin Market goes back as far as 70 years.
